Windows 11 Support & Integration Specialist (5 months contract)
Windows 11 Support & Integration Specialist (5 months contract)
We are seeking a highly motivated and proactive Windows 11 Support & Integration Specialist to join our team. The successful candidate will play a key role in supporting users through the full integration process, troubleshooting technical issues, and delivering exceptional service in a high-pressure, financial environment. This role will also involve post-migration support, technical deskside assistance, and collaboration with project teams to meet strict deadlines and targets.
Key Responsibilities:
- User Support & Integration
- Support users through the full integration and migration process to Windows 11.
- Provide post-migration assistance and ensure user satisfaction.
- Deliver training and build strong relationships with end users.
- Technical Support & Troubleshooting
- Build and rebuild devices to meet Windows 11 specifications.
- Troubleshoot and resolve Windows 11-related issues.
- Complete deskside and technical support queries as required.
- Support the Project team with tasks, pilots, and initiatives.
- Attend team calls and contribute to discussions on best practices.
- Work to meet weekly and monthly targets within defined deadlines.
- Provide out-of-hours support when agreed in advance to support project milestones.
Requirements & Qualifications:
- Experience & Knowledge
- Proven experience supporting clients in a financial environment.
- Strong background in Windows 11 troubleshooting and integration.
- Excellent track record of delivering customer service-based support.
- Experience managing technical issues and prioritizing according to business impact.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Excellent time management and organizational skills.
- Ability to multi-task and work effectively under pressure.
- Analytical mindset and attention to detail.
- Proactive, flexible, and solution-focused approach.
- Able to work independently and collaboratively in a team.
- Takes ownership of issues and follows through to resolution and root cause.
- Demonstrable drive and motivation to achieve success.
- Strong understanding of device build processes and hardware requirements for Windows 11.
- Familiarity with ITIL practices and service desk operations.
- Previous involvement in large-scale IT migration or transformation projects.
